#f97e32 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f97e32 is composed of 97.6% red, 49.4%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 49.4% magenta, 79.9%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 22.9 degrees, a saturation of 94.3% and a lightness of 58.6%. #f97e32 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ffc64 with #f30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

Shades and Tints of #f97e32

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050200 is the darkest color, while #fff6f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f97e32

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#989593 is the less saturated color, while #f97e32 is the most saturated one.
